
The Star Trek 40th Anniversary Type II Phaser has 4 power settings (ranging from “tickle” to “cinder”) and an overload setting, and tranforms quickly into a Type I phaser with full lights and sound. As a kid I’d always hoped the future would hold handheld devices like this that could really do this to a reporter.
